The Church of Santiago el Mayor (in Spanish, Iglesia de Santiago el Mayor) is an important church. You can find it in the city of Guadalajara, Spain. It is a very old and special building.

What Makes This Church Special?

A Protected Treasure

The Church of Santiago el Mayor is not just any church. In 1946, it was given a special title. It was declared a Bien de Interés Cultural. This Spanish phrase means "Property of Cultural Interest."

What is a Bien de Interés Cultural?

When something is a Bien de Interés Cultural, it means it is very important. It is a treasure for the country. The Spanish government protects these places. They want to make sure they last for a long time. This way, future generations can also enjoy them.
